#814c38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#814c38 is composed of 50.6% red, 29.8%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 56.6%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 16.4 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 36.3%. #814c38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9870 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#814c38 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#814c38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#814c38 has RGB values of R:129, G:76,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.57,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8473656.

Shades and Tints of #814c38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060303 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#814c38
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5c5c is the less saturated color, while #b33506 is the most saturated one.
